发明名称 Method of co-culturing mammalian muscle cells and motoneurons
摘要 The invention provides a method of co-culturing mammalian muscle cells and mammalian motoneurons. The method comprises preparing one or more carriers coated with a covalently bonded monolayer of trimethoxysilylpropyl diethylenetriamine (DETA); suspending isolated fetal mammalian skeletal muscle cells in serum-free medium according to medium composition 1; suspending isolated fetal mammalian spinal motoneurons in serum-free medium according to medium composition 1; plating the suspended muscle cells onto the one or more carriers at a predetermined density and allowing the muscle cells to attach; plating the suspended motoneurons at a predetermined density onto the one or more carriers and allowing the motoneurons to attach; covering the one or more carriers with a mixture of medium composition 1 and medium composition 2; and incubating the carriers covered in the media mixture.

主权项 1. A method of co-culturing mammalian muscle cells and motoneurons, the method comprising: suspending fetal muscle cells and fetal spinal motoneurons in a serum-free medium according to composition 1 of Table 1; placing the suspended fetal muscle cells and fetal spinal motoneurons onto a monolayer of covalently bonded trimethoxysilylpropyl-diethylenetriamine supported on an underlying carrier surface; covering the carrier comprising muscle cells and motoneurons in a mixture of serum-free medium composition 1 of Table 1 and serum-free medium composition 2 of Table 2; and incubating the covered carrier comprising muscle cells and motoneurons.
